Sidewalk widening services involve expanding existing walkways to provide more space for pedestrians. This process typically includes removing the current sidewalk surface, grading the underlying ground for proper slope and stability, and pouring new concrete or other durable materials to create a broader pathway. The goal is to improve accessibility, accommodate increased foot traffic, or enhance the overall appearance of a property’s sidewalk area. These services are performed by experienced contractors who ensure the new surface is level, safe, and built to withstand weather and daily use.
Widening a sidewalk can help address several common problems faced by property owners. Narrow or damaged walkways can create safety hazards, especially for individuals with mobility challenges or those pushing strollers or wheelchairs. Over time, sidewalks may crack, settle, or become uneven, increasing the risk of trips and falls. Expanding and repairing sidewalks also helps prevent water pooling or erosion issues that can cause further deterioration. By upgrading these surfaces, property owners can improve safety, meet local accessibility standards, and reduce ongoing maintenance concerns.

The overview below groups typical Sidewalk Widening proj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ashburn,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- fixing minor sidewalk widening issues typically costs between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this range involve simple adjustments or patching.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ed this range, but are less common.
Moderate Widening Projects - expanding sidewalks in moderate areas generally falls between $1,000 and $3,000. Many local contractors handle these jobs within this band, though larger projects with additional features may cost more.
Full Sidewalk Replacement - replacing an entire sidewalk section often ranges from $4,000 to $8,000, depending on size and materials. Such projects are less frequent and tend to be on the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- extensive sidewalk widening involving multiple blocks or intricate designs can reach $10,000 or more. These are typically specialized jobs that require significant planning and resources, making them less common than standard repairs or expansions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
